He's perfect in the morning
   his eyes still heavy with sleep
His beard rough and ragged
   dark against his cheek.

He's perfect at midday
   after working in the yard
With sweat upon his body
    and dirt smudged across his face.

He's perfect in the evening
   fresh and ready for some fun
With laughter lighting up
   his eyes

He's perfect in the nightime
   held close upon our bed
Sharing pleasure and passion
   till the morning sun.

He's perfect in my eyes
   in my heart and in my soul
My partner, my soul mate
   my lover...my own
